Lecture Notes in Computer Science 7105, 183-189 (2011). py: 2011 pu: Berlin: Springer la: EN cc: ut: Wireless Sensor Networks; Routing Protocol; Broadcasting; Energy Efficient ci: li: doi:10.1007/978-3-642-27142-7_21 ab: Summary: Network architectures and protocols are important aspects in the design of wireless sensor networks (WSNs). Due to the severe energy constraint of sensor nodes, network architectural design has a big impact on the energy consumption and thus the operational lifetime of the whole network. To prolong the lifetime of WSNs, energy efficiency should be considered. We propose an energy efficient routing algorithm that establishes routing table using broadcasting which is cyclically transmitting and conduct performance analysis with simulation method. rv:
